    Primary Purpose:

    Assist in managing the district's transportation operations. Ensure safe, efficient, and reliable delivery of services through oversight of daily operations, personnel, routing, fleet utilization, and compliance with all applicable laws and district policies. This position serves as a key operational leader responsible for maintaining continuity of services and supporting the overall performance and accountability of the transportation department

    Qualifications:
    Education/Certification:

    • Bachelor's degree (preferred)

    • Clear and valid Texas commercial driver's license with Passenger (P) and School Bus (S) endorsements

    Special Knowledge/Skills:

    • Ability to direct and manage operations of a large fleet of vehicles

    • Ability to pass U.S. Department of Transportation alcohol and drug tests and annual physical exam

    • Knowledge of energy management and vehicle repair and maintenance

    • Ability to conduct on-site inspections of all vehicle repair and maintenance operations

    • Ability to manage budget and personnel

    • Ability to implement policy and procedures

    • Ability to interpret data

    • Ability to use technology to plan, operate, monitor, and evaluate transportation operations

    • Strong organizational, communication, and interpersonal skills

    • Ability to analyze operational data to improve efficiency and cost effectiveness

    • Ability to monitor service delivery and proactively address operational gaps

    • Ability to lead teams and align supervisors to ensure consistency in expectations and execution 

    • Strong decision-making skills in fast-paced, high-pressure environments

    Experience:
    5 years' experience as a bus driver

    5 years of progressively responsible supervisory or leadership experience, preferably in school transportation or a related field 

    Demonstrated experience managing employee performance, attendance, and accountability


    Work Schedule: 221 days
